Released in 2014, (Korean: 신의 한 수) is a South Korean neo-noir action thriller that uniquely blends the intellectual strategy of the board game Go (known as Baduk in Korea) with the visceral violence of a revenge drama. Directed by Jo Bum-gu , the film presents a world where the ancient game becomes a deadly underground gambling enterprise. Plot Summary: The Quest for Vengeance

Unlike traditional psychological thrillers, The Divine Move juxtaposes quiet, intellectual board games with brutal, visceral hand-to-hand combat. The knife fights and prison brawl sequences are precisely choreographed, offering a raw intensity reminiscent of classics like Oldboy and The Man from Nowhere . The narrative follows Tae-seok (Jung Woo-sung), a professional Go player who is framed for the murder of his own brother after a high-stakes underground game goes horribly wrong. Destroyed, humiliated, and sent to prison, Tae-seok spends his incarceration transforming his mind and body. He masters the art of physical combat from a mysterious inmate while sharpening his mental Go strategies.
